What Is Responsive Service Promotion? A Strategic Overview

Responsive service promotion is a data-driven, adaptive marketing methodology that delivers personalized incentives—such as discounts, free shipping, or bundles—at key shopper moments like product views, cart abandonment, or checkout hesitation. Unlike traditional static campaigns, it continuously responds to live customer signals to maximize conversions and minimize drop-offs.

Core Principles of Responsive Service Promotion

Principle Description
Behavioral responsiveness Detects exit intent, checkout hesitation, or inactivity to trigger timely, relevant offers.
Personalization Tailors promotions using segmentation, purchase history, and browsing patterns.
Feedback integration Incorporates exit-intent surveys and post-purchase feedback (e.g., via tools like Zigpoll) to refine offers.
Cross-channel consistency Maintains coherent messaging across product pages, cart, checkout, and post-purchase touchpoints.
Data-driven optimization Continuously measures effectiveness and iterates offers using real-time analytics.

Step-by-Step Guide: Implementing Responsive Service Promotion in Centra

1. Define Clear Objectives and KPIs

Set measurable goals tailored to peak season challenges, such as:

  • Reduce cart abandonment by 15%
  • Increase checkout completion by 10%
  • Boost average order value by 10%

Align KPIs with these objectives for focused tracking and accountability.

2. Deploy Real-Time Behavior Tracking

Implement tracking on Centra product pages, carts, and checkout flows to capture key user actions and triggers like exit intent or inactivity. Recommended tools include:

  • Google Analytics Enhanced Ecommerce: For detailed funnel visualization.
  • Mixpanel: For granular behavior segmentation and event tracking.
  • Hotjar: For heatmaps and session recordings.

3. Segment Your Audience for Targeted Offers

Leverage CRM and ecommerce data to create meaningful segments based on purchase frequency, cart size, and browsing behavior:

  • High-value repeat customers
  • First-time visitors
  • Cart abandoners

This segmentation enables precise, personalized promotions.

4. Build a Dynamic Promotion Catalog

Develop a flexible library of offers—discounts, free shipping, bundles—with clear eligibility rules. Utilize Centra’s promotion engine or third-party platforms like Voucherify or Talon.One to automate delivery based on real-time triggers.

5. Integrate Exit-Intent and In-Session Surveys with Tools Like Zigpoll

Deploy exit-intent surveys on checkout and cart pages to collect immediate feedback from hesitant shoppers. Platforms such as Zigpoll provide real-time insights that help uncover friction points and inform smarter promotional adjustments.

6. Test, Analyze, and Optimize Continuously

Conduct A/B tests comparing static and responsive promotions during peak periods. Track metrics such as conversion rate, AOV, and customer satisfaction scores from survey platforms including Zigpoll. Use these insights to refine offers iteratively.

7. Align Marketing and Fulfillment Teams

Ensure consistent promotion messaging across email, onsite banners, and checkout. Coordinate fulfillment logistics—discount codes, shipping—to avoid delays or errors that undermine customer trust.

8. Scale Successful Tactics with Automation

Automate high-performing responsive promotions using Centra APIs or marketing automation tools like Klaviyo or Braze. Expand triggers to additional segments and sales channels for broader impact.


Measuring the Impact of Responsive Service Promotions: Key Metrics

Tracking both direct and indirect outcomes provides a comprehensive view of success:

Metric What It Measures Example Target Improvement
Cart abandonment rate Percentage of shoppers leaving before checkout Reduce from 70% to 55%
Checkout conversion rate Percentage completing purchase after initiating checkout Increase from 40% to 50%
Average order value (AOV) Average revenue per transaction Increase from $75 to $85
Customer satisfaction (CSAT) Positive feedback via surveys Achieve 85% positive rating (collected via platforms such as Zigpoll)
Promotion redemption rate Percentage of targeted users redeeming responsive offers Target >30% utilization on exit-intent offers
Repeat purchase rate Percentage making subsequent purchases Increase by 10% post-promotion

Pro tip: Use cohort analysis to isolate the impact of responsive promotions by comparing users exposed to dynamic offers against those who receive static or no offers.

Managing Risks in Responsive Service Promotion

To protect brand reputation and profitability, proactively address common risks:

Risk Mitigation Strategy
Promotion overuse Limit frequency and stacking; use A/B testing to balance offers.
User experience disruption Ensure pop-ups and offers do not slow checkout or frustrate users. (Tools like Zigpoll help identify such UX issues early.)
Brand inconsistency Align responsive content with brand voice and style guidelines.
Fraud and abuse Implement validation rules to restrict promo eligibility.
Margin erosion Monitor financial impact; adjust offers to protect profitability.

FAQ: Responsive Service Promotion Strategy Insights

How do I start responsive service promotion with limited data?

Begin by deploying simple exit-intent surveys on checkout pages using platforms such as Zigpoll. Use early feedback to identify key friction points and test straightforward targeted offers like free shipping to hesitant users.

What’s the difference between responsive service promotion and traditional discounting?

Responsive promotion adapts offers in real-time based on user behavior and feedback, while traditional discounting relies on static, calendar-driven campaigns without personalization.

Can responsive service promotion increase customer loyalty?

Yes. Personalized, timely offers improve customer satisfaction, leading to higher repeat purchase rates and increased lifetime value.

How often should promotions be updated during peak seasons?

Monitor performance daily or hourly during peaks. Adjust offers weekly based on data insights, and automate minor real-time tweaks wherever possible.
